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Brockton to Manchester is to line 12 bus and bus which costs $12 - $21 and takes 3h 20m.
The fastest way to get from Brockton to Manchester is to drive which takes 1h 28m and costs $13 - $20.
No, there is no direct bus from Brockton to Manchester. However, there are services departing from Main St and Church St and arriving at Manchester(Veterans Memorial Park) via Boston.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 20m.
The distance between Brockton and Manchester is 74 miles. The road distance is 73.8 miles.
The best way to get from Brockton to Manchester without a car is to train and bus which takes 2h 51m and costs $11 - $26.
It takes approximately 2h 51m to get from Brockton to Manchester, including transfers.
